Blick von der alten Maas auf Dordrecht
1650
From the collection of Art Collection of the University Göttingen
Blick von der alten Maas auf Dordrecht is a 1650 by Unknown, depicting Wood, held at Art Collection of the University Göttingen.
This painting depicts a serene scene of a river, with a large sailboat in the foreground and several smaller boats in the distance. The sky is cloudy, with a few birds flying overhead. In the background, there are buildings and trees along the riverbank. The painting is rendered in muted colors, with a focus on grays and browns. The brushstrokes are loose and expressive, giving the painting a sense of movement and energy.
